# Common Bugs & Pitfalls
## Auth redirect loop (index.html ↔ dashboard.html)
**Symptom**: Page constantly refreshes between index.html and dashboard.html.
**Root cause**: `index.html` line 131 blindly checks `localStorage.getItem('pocketbase_auth')` — any truthy value (including stale/expired tokens) triggers a redirect to dashboard.html. Dashboard's `onAuthStateChanged` then detects the invalid token and bounces back to index.html, but the stale token is never cleared from localStorage.
**Fix**: In every file that redirects unauthenticated users back to index.html, clear the stale token first:
```javascript
localStorage.removeItem('pocketbase_auth');
window.location.href = 'index.html';
```
Files that need this: `dashboard.js` (line 122), `appointments.js` (line 50), `repair-orders.js` (line 58).
## PocketBase auto-cancellation ("request was auto-cancelled")
**Symptom**: Creating/updating records fails with "The request was auto-cancelled" or similar abort error.
**Root cause**: PocketBase SDK auto-cancels requests that share the same `requestKey`. By default, all `create`/`update` calls to the same collection share the same key — a rapid double-click fires two identical requests and the first is aborted.
**Fix — two parts**:
1. Disable auto-cancellation in `pocketbase.js` by passing `{ requestKey: null }` to all mutating PocketBase calls:
- `addDoc`: `pb.collection(collName).create(pbData, { requestKey: null })`
- `updateDoc`: `pb.collection(collName).update(docId, pbData, { requestKey: null })`
- `setDoc`: both internal `update` and `create` calls need it
2. Add double-submission guard to form submit handlers — disable the button on first click:
```javascript
const submitBtn = document.getElementById('submit-create-ro');
if (submitBtn && submitBtn.disabled) return;
if (submitBtn) {
submitBtn.disabled = true;
submitBtn.textContent = 'Creating...';
}
```
Re-enable the button in BOTH the success path (after form clear/collapse) AND the catch block on error. Forgetting the success path leaves the button permanently disabled after a successful submission.
## DuckDNS DNS stale / site unreachable
**Symptom**: "This site can't be reached" when accessing grajmedia.duckdns.org.
**Check order**:
1. `dig +short grajmedia.duckdns.org` — if returns `127.0.0.1`, run the DuckDNS updater manually: `bash /opt/duckdns/update.sh`
2. The cron job runs every 5 min: `*/5 * * * * /opt/duckdns/update.sh`
3. `/etc/hosts` has `127.0.0.1 grajmedia.duckdns.org` for local hairpin NAT — this is intentional, not a bug
## Dashboard Completed counter shows 0 (`ro.status` vs `ro.workStatus`)
**Symptom**: "Completed: 0" on the dashboard Repair Orders Today card, despite having completed orders today.
**Root causes (usually BOTH apply)**:
1. **Wrong field**: Code filters by `ro.status === 'completed'` but `status` only stores `waiter`/`drop-off`. Must use `ro.workStatus === 'completed'`.
2. **Completed orders filtered out at source**: `loadRepairOrders()` in dashboard.js removes all completed orders from `dashboardData.repairOrders` before any counter can see them.
**Fix checklist**:
- Replace ALL `ro.status === 'completed'` with `ro.workStatus === 'completed'`
- Replace ALL `ro.status === 'picked-up'` with `ro.workStatus === 'waiting-for-pickup'`
- Remove the completed-filter from `loadRepairOrders()` so `dashboardData.repairOrders` contains ALL orders
- Each consumer then filters by `ro.workStatus` as needed
